Hepatitis B virus quasispecies susceptibility to entecavir confirms the relationship between genotypic resistance and patient virologic response.
Journal of hepatology - 1 Jun 2008
Baldick Carl J, Eggers Betsy J, Fang Jie, Levine Steven M, Pokornowski Kevin A, Rose Ronald E, Yu Cheng-Fang, Tenney Daniel J, Colonno Richard J
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ND/AIMS: The efficacy of anti-viral therapy for chronic hepatitis B virus (HBV) is lost upon the emergence of resistant virus. Using >500 patient HBV isolates from several entecavir clinical trials, we show that phenotypic susceptibility correlates with genotypic resistance and patient virologic responses. METHODS: The full-length HBV or reverse transcriptase gene was amplified from patient sera,...
